реклама на сайте
подробности

 
 
> AT91RM9200 + MMC, совсем тупой вопрос
Piligrim1158
сообщение May 23 2007, 08:17
Сообщение #1


Участник
*

Группа: Новичок
Сообщений: 26
Регистрация: 16-05-07
Пользователь №: 27 755



Извините за тупой вопрос, но есть проблема.
Есть отладочная плата RT-SBC20Sv1, по ее образу и подобию развели свою, проц AT91AR9200 208 лапый, память MT48LC16M16A2. DataFlash:AT45DB161.

Значит пока не проблема, просто не понимаю что на отладочной плате. Там Стоят 2а разьема для ММС, стоят параллельно друг другу(если верить тестеру), подключены по однопроводной линии на проц, на портА 27,28,29.

Вопрос в следующем, на одном разьеме карта запускается нормально и определяется и грузится с нее, а вот на втором полная ерунда, при обращении к карте сразу отваливаемся. Почему так происходит? Держатели находятся на разных сторонах плат, друг под другом.

Интересеут это в основном из-за того, что скоро доберусь до карты и может оказаться что при правильной разводке карта на подцепится.
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
Piligrim1158
сообщение May 25 2007, 06:32
Сообщение #2


Участник
*

Группа: Новичок
Сообщений: 26
Регистрация: 16-05-07
Пользователь №: 27 755



Почистил контакты и поехало на 2х разбемах, но всплыла другая проблема. Частенько стало, что после инициальзации карты и начала работы с ней она отваливается со связи.
Т.е. проходит инициальзация, пишел в терминалку размер карты, грузим с нее пару файлов и отваливаемся по неответу по карте:
....................
eth0: Link down.
eth0: AT91 ethernet at 0xfefbc000 int=24 10-HalfDuplex (00:de:ad:00:00:65)
eth0: Realtek RTL8201(cool.gifL PHY
Uniform Multi-Platform E-IDE driver Revision: 7.00alpha2
ide: Assuming 50MHz system bus speed for PIO modes; override with idebus=xx
ide-at91rm9200rt: registering channel 0 at c480601c, irq 25
ide-at91rm9200rt: unable to register
mice: PS/2 mouse device common for all mice
at91_rtc at91_rtc: rtc intf: dev (254:0)
at91_rtc at91_rtc: rtc core: registered at91_rtc as rtc0
AT91 Real Time Clock driver.
MMC: 4 wire bus mode not supported by this driver - using 1 wire
TCP cubic registered
Initializing XFRM netlink socket
NET: Registered protocol family 1
NET: Registered protocol family 17
802.1Q VLAN Support v1.8 Ben Greear <greearb@candelatech.com>
All bugs added by David S. Miller <davem@redhat.com>
at91_rtc at91_rtc: setting the system clock to 1998-01-01 00:00:23 (883612823)
mmcblk0: mmc0:0001 509184KiB <-------------------- как я понял карту тут опросили
mmcblk0: p1
EXT2-fs warning: mounting unchecked fs, running e2fsck is recommended
VFS: Mounted root (ext2 filesystem).
Freeing init memory: 76K
INIT: version 2.86 booting
Unable to handle kernel paging request at virtual address e19fffdf
pgd = c3dd0000
[e19fffdf] *pgd=00000000
Internal error: Oops: 3 [#1]
Modules linked in:
CPU: 0
PC is at elv_rb_add+0x20/0x70
LR is at sysdev_suspend+0x58/0x220

и т.д.

т.е. как я понимаю карту мы подняли, опросили и упали на этом. причем переодически проходит нормальная загрузка. Может опять теория контактов? smile.gif
Карта стоит ММС+ на 512 Метров. работает в режиме ммс, длинна проводников примерно 3-4 см, возле карты стоят продольные 20 ом. и подтяжки на +3.3.
Go to the top of the page
 
+Quote Post
KAlex
сообщение May 25 2007, 07:48
Сообщение #3


Местный
***

Группа: Свой
Сообщений: 387
Регистрация: 20-12-06
Из: Obninsk
Пользователь №: 23 719



Цитата(Piligrim1158 @ May 25 2007, 10:32) *
Почистил контакты и поехало на 2х разбемах

Разебах!м lol.gif
Спиртиком протри, а перед этим стиральной резинкой.
Go to the top of the page
 
+Quote Post
Piligrim1158
сообщение May 25 2007, 08:03
Сообщение #4


Участник
*

Группа: Новичок
Сообщений: 26
Регистрация: 16-05-07
Пользователь №: 27 755



Ну опечатался случайно))
некатит)) так и теряет карту) может продольники уменьшить и подтяжки снять? или возле проца еще Ом по 10 поставить?

Просто я с ММС еще не работал никогда. smile.gif учимся ))
Go to the top of the page
 
+Quote Post
KAlex
сообщение May 25 2007, 08:22
Сообщение #5


Местный
***

Группа: Свой
Сообщений: 387
Регистрация: 20-12-06
Из: Obninsk
Пользователь №: 23 719



Цитата(Piligrim1158 @ May 25 2007, 12:03) *
Ну опечатался случайно))
некатит)) так и теряет карту) может продольники уменьшить и подтяжки снять? или возле проца еще Ом по 10 поставить?

Просто я с ММС еще не работал никогда. smile.gif учимся ))

Подтяжки необходимы(50-100к), а вот продольники нах.
Есть неплохой даташит SanDisk_MMC+RS-MMC_PM_1.0, 1,7Мб, могу намылить.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 23rd July 2025 - 11:57
Рейтинг@Mail.ru


Страница сгенерированна за 0.01377 секунд с 7
ELECTRONIX ©2004-2016